1 CONTINUING PARTICIPATION CHOICE If you re ready to retire and confident your practice will continue to thrive under the leadership of your successor this could be the ideal choice for you. Designed to provide you with a stream of payments based on the practice s ongoing value, this approach can help you share in the success of the business you ve worked so hard to build, even after you ve retired. PLANNING FOR THE FUTURE OF YOUR BUSINESS 2 ONE-TIME PAYMENT CHOICE For those looking for a more definitive transition, this choice offers you immediate full liquidity and a precise valuation of your practice. It could generate more upside potential for a successor advisor who anticipates exceptional client retention and is seeking to maximize the value of growth potential. It also presents your successor with the unique opportunity to finance the acquisition with a five-year loan from Raymond James at the current interest rate. Illustrative Impact of One-Time Payment Year 1 Year 2 Year 3 Year 4 Year 5 Total Retired FA Practice Production $600,000 $600,000 $600,000 $600,000 $600,000 $3,000,000 Successor FA Pre-Acquisition Production $1,000,000 $1,000,000 $1,000,000 $1,000,000 $1,000,000 $5,000,000 Successor FA Future Production $1,600,000 $1,600,000 $1,600,000 $1,600,000 $1,600,000 $8,000,000 Successor FA Future Payout $736,000 $736,000 $736,000 $736,000 $736,000 $3,680,000 Acquired Practice Payout $276,000 $276,000 $276,000 $276,000 $276,000 $1,380,000 Successor FA Loan Repayment $91,920 $91,920 $91,920 $91,920 $91,920 $459,600 Successor FA Acquired Production Net Payout $184,080 $184,080 $184,080 $184,080 $184,080 $920,400 This illustration uses a one-time payment of $406,350. This choice enables the retiring advisor and the successor to select a fixed price for the practice, payable in full at retirement. Raymond James will provide financing to the successor repayable to the firm over up to five years, subject to available credit reports and firm approval. In this illustration, the one-time payment is assumed to be equal to the maximum loan amount available under the program s multifactor lending formula.
